Q: How do I rotate secrets with Spindlecrank?

A: Run the rotate command against the target namespace. Spindlecrank swaps credentials, updates dependent services, and verifies connectivity before retiring the old secret. Rotation is atomic; a failed step rolls back automatically. Contractors get read-only dry-run access by default — full rotation requires sponsor approval. If Spindlecrank itself loses its root binding, re-seal it using the recovery passphrase below.

unlock words, yawig-kagef: gordor-holvan-ulaael-pramir-ulaiel-tamdor

Heads up, future maintainers: if catalog pages in Shelfwright show stale prices after a deploy, it's almost always the CI cache-warm step finishing before the invalidation sweep does. The two jobs race, and the warmer happily repopulates dead entries. Quick fix is rerunning the sweep job alone; real fix is making warm depend on sweep. When filing a ticket, include the build token printed below.

trace token, hahaf-tahof: htk6_c05966

TURN-208: Gatevale turnstile counters at the Merrow Field pilot double-count when a rotation reverses mid-cycle. Attendance totals drift roughly 2% high per event. The debounce window fix is implemented, reviewed by Ilsa, and soak-tested across two simulated match days without drift. Ready for your cut; the candidate build is identified below.

trace token, tagag-tafog: htk6_5ed18c